Keys with transponders

There are a variety of car keys that are available on the market. The best one to choose depends on your needs and preferences. Some keys are more user-friendly, while others offer more security. Keys with transponders are a good option for those who need additional security against theft. They are equipped with a chip inside the head that transmits signals to your car's computer when it is inserted into the ignition. These signals are then verified by the car's computer to verify that the key is genuine and authorized. This helps prevent thieves from starting the vehicle using the incorrect key.

Transponder chips are relatively new technology and are usually integrated into the key head. These chips are designed for the transmission of the unique serial number each time inserted into the ignition. This information is read by the transponder reader of the car, which is linked with the ignition. If the data matches, the car will start. This method is more secure than mechanical keys because it prevents hot wiring. It is not foolproof. The thieves have found ways to get around this security feature.

Keys equipped with transponder chips

If your car was constructed in the last 20 years or so it is likely to have a key with a transponder chip inside of it. These devices, which are often called chip keys or ignition keys can help stop car thefts by making it difficult for thieves to wire your vehicle. They are also used in garage door openers and home alarm systems.

Transponder chips (pictured below) are tiny microchips embedded in the head of your reprogramming car keys keys. They transmit a signal to the computer in your vehicle whenever the key is used to turn the ignition on and start the motor. The signal is sent through an antenna ring that surrounds the ignition cylinder and must be received by your car for it to begin. The immobilizer system will be activated if your car key programer cannot recognize the signal generated by your key.

Car theft was a huge problem in the past, before this technology was widely used. Hot-wiring is a simple technique that many thieves use to steal your car. They could fool the computer in the car to believe that the key was genuine by simply wrapping wires around it.

This new technology helped to remove the need for hot-wiring and as a result car thefts dropped dramatically. GM was the very first US manufacturer to utilize this technology on their 1985 Corvette. Since the time, all major auto manufacturers have integrated the technology into their vehicles.

Most people are familiar with way a regular transponder key appears. They look like a traditional metal key with a plastic top. The chip is housed in the plastic top of the key and is referred to as a "chip key".
